New iRiver SPINN PMP has Flash Lite UI and games

Sunday, August 3rd, 2008

iRiver launched their new Portable Media Player (PMP) called the SPINN that has (among many really cool features) a Flash Lite 2.1 user interface as well as pre-installed Flash Games.

The Flash Lite user interace in action with the SPINN control

Flash Lite UI on the Verizon Wireless LG Chocolate 3 (VX8650)

Friday, August 1st, 2008

I finally got into the “guts” of the LG Chocolate 3 (VX8650) and was able to browse around some of the file structure.
I found that like many handsets now shipping from LG, the LG Chocolate 3 (VX8650) is also using Flash Lite for the user interface (see below), which is pretty cool.

19 mobile devices from Verizon Wireless support Flash Lite content

Thursday, July 31st, 2008

According to some updated data from Bill, there are now 19 mobile devices on the Verizon network which are BREW enabled and support Flash Lite (2.1) content.
So, 6 additional devices have been certified and extensions are now available).
Here they are:
 · LG VX5300 (added)
 · LG VX8700 (added)
 · LG VX8350 (added)
 · Motorola RAZR V9m (added)

LG Voyager (VX10000) uses Flash Lite for some of its user interface

Friday, July 25th, 2008

Recently, I picked up a Verizon Wireless LG Verizon Voyager (aka, the “LG VX10000″) handset which I found leverages Flash Lite 2.x for pieces of the user interface.
